ABOUT TRAVIS DEWITZ
Travis Dewitz is a commercial photographer from Wisconsin working throughout the Midwest. This website features his personal work that typically has a focus towards photojournalism while his portrait work has an editorial flare. His work spans from beautifully graceful ballerinas to the abandoned coal towns of West Virginia. He is also the author of the award winning book, Blaze Orange, that documents the deep culture of the yearly Wisconsin deer hunt.
